Q: How do Multi Effect Evaporators achieve high evaporation efficiency?
A: Multi Effect Evaporators use multiple stages (effects), each utilizing the vapor from the previous stage to maximize heat efficiency, providing up to 95% evaporation efficiency while saving energy and operational costs.

Q: What is the process for cleaning and maintaining these evaporators?
A: An optional CIP (Clean-In-Place) system allows for automated internal cleaning, reducing manual effort, downtime, and enhancing operational hygiene without disassembly.
